Howard Lake-Waverly-Winsted Public Schools, Independent School District 2687, serves the communities of Winsted, Waverly, and Howard Lake. We are dedicated to providing a high- quality education for our youth. With that commitment, we strive for excellence and opportunity for each student in every offering and activity of the school district.
Serving nearly 1300 students, K-12, in two elementary schools (K-2 and 3-4), a middle school (5-8), and a high school (9-12), we offer educational opportunities using a healthy balance between one-to-one technology, hands-on skills, enrichment, and remediation.

Humphrey & Winsted Elementary
With two elementary schools to serve our three communities, we set out to establish a solid foundation of core academic instruction. Humphrey Elementary is home to our primary students, serving Kindergarten through second grade students, and also is home to different preschool opportunities. Winsted Elementary is home to our intermediate grade students, serving third and fourth grade students. Winsted also provides preschool opportunities as well. Keeping class sizes low and supplementing with support staff including paraprofessionals, social workers, SLPs and SLPAs, both Humphrey and Winsted Elementary have created a positive, enriching experience for all our students and families.
Much of what we do as elementary schools is established through strong connections made between staff and students. Our staff members really get to know each and every child, and through the use of Nurtured Heart Approach, we make sure that there are adults who look out for the needs of everyone.
Our schools were remodeled and additions were made to both facilities in 2007. Our student population at both schools continues to grow not only in numbers, but in excitement about all the possibilities our schools make into a reality.
Honorees of the United States Department of Education's National Blue Ribbon (Humphrey 2012 & Winsted 2013), and recent recipients of MESPA's School of Excellence Award, our elementary schools are top notch!
